Grade: 5.1 Hours: 40 hours per week, Monday – Friday (Occasional weekend work) Location: Portsmouth, PO3 5QH When you see the world as we do, you see the chance to help the world take better care of its resources and help it become a better place for everyone. As a Maintenance Engineer you\’ll be pushing for innovative solutions to create a more sustainable future for all. We know that everyone here at Veolia can help us work alongside our communities, look after the environment, and contribute to our inclusive culture. What we can offer you; 25 days of annual leave plus bank holidays Access to our company pension scheme Free physiotherapy service Discounts on everything from groceries to well known retailers Access to a range of resources to support your physical, mental and financial health; so you can lean on us whenever you need to Ongoing training and development opportunities, allowing you to reach your full potential What you\’ll be doing; Implement planned preventative maintenance, overhauls and planned shutdown works within strict budgets Oversee maintenance sub contractors Plan, organise and supervise all maintenance work required on site(s) Monitor and ensure compliance with health & safety legislation Respond promptly to emergency breakdown situations Record keeping of maintenance and audit information Stock control What we\’re looking for; Essential: Time served as an electrical engineer City and Guilds in Engineering plus formal qualification in electrical maintenance Processing, manufacturing, production industry background Experience of hydraulics Knowledge & experience of working with mobile plant Desirable: Background and training in both Mechanical and Electrical engineering Full driving licence – travel to other sites may be required What\’s next?
